Output db3a32150ed3ab65ed70b64f77637e8a5283dc4ec98dc757616763276b7b9fbb:36

value
32901640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d851fc86f4f708841069071274523892a1e7a73d OP_EQUAL
address
MTcxQPAFwnAk1WvLTqr5WkGDxRLyBqnpWd
transaction
db3a32150ed3ab65ed70b64f77637e8a5283dc4ec98dc757616763276b7b9fbb
spent
true